WebA period happens because of changes in hormones in the body. Hormones are chemical messengers. The ovaries release the female hormones estrogen and progesterone. These hormones cause the lining of the uterus (or womb) to build up. The built-up lining is ready for a fertilized egg to attach to and start developing. Puberty is the process in which a child has a growth spurt and develops the sexual physical features of an adult. In the brain, the hypothalamus releases chemicals (hormones) that cause the pituitary gland to release hormones called gonadotropins.
WebThese hormones cause the first signs of puberty, which are breast development, body odor, underarm hair, pubic hair and acne (pimples).
